Transaction

e268d61c5b23cdbb18722f854133cbae3f27a43ea8b7913eaaeb27fd89d9c70c

Summary

In Block758802
TimeFri, 04 Aug 2017 10:39:30 UTC
Total Input3094.68795643 PIV
Total Output3099.18794603 PIV
Fees0 PIV

Details

Fee: 0 PIV
4019333 Confirmations3099.18794603 PIV
Raw Transaction